Description

Carnegie Village Rehabilitation & Health Care Center in Belton, MO is an exceptional assisted living community offering a wide range of amenities and care services. Our residents enjoy the convenience of on-site beauty salon services, cable or satellite TV in their fully furnished accommodations, and the opportunity to stay connected with Wi-Fi/high-speed internet.

Our community operated transportation ensures that residents can easily get around town for appointments or errands. For those who enjoy technology, we have a computer center available for use.

Meals are a highlight at Carnegie Village, with options for restaurant-style dining in our spacious dining room. Our skilled chefs can accommodate special dietary restrictions and create delicious meals following a diabetes diet if needed.

Residents have access to various recreational activities to keep them engaged and entertained. They can socialize in our gaming room or small library, participate in fitness programs in our fitness room, or enjoy the outdoor space and garden. Planned day trips and resident-run activities provide opportunities for exploration and connection.

Our dedicated staff provides 24-hour supervision and assistance with activities of daily living such as bathing, dressing, and transfers. Medication management ensures that residents receive their medications promptly and accurately. We also offer move-in coordination services to ease the transition into our community.

In terms of nearby amenities, Carnegie Village is conveniently located near cafes, parks, pharmacies, physicians' offices, restaurants, and places of worship.

At Carnegie Village Rehabilitation & Health Care Center in Belton, MO, we prioritize the well-being and comfort of our residents by providing excellent care services and an inviting community atmosphere.
